Alcohol Related Harm Reduction Programs

Taxonomy Code: RX-8470.0500

Programs that provide services which employ treatment strategies other than abstinence in order to reach and help individuals with severe alcohol use disorders, particularly those who are homeless and/or may be using unsafe sources of liquor such as industrial products. Included are community and hospital based programs, and "wet" shelters that allow limited and monitored use of alcohol. The focus is on minimizing the negative consequences of drinking and improving health, diet and quality of life without emphasizing sobriety or reduction in use.
